Orange

Orange Holiday SIM card is an excellent choice for those traveling in Europe. It offers 30GB of 4G data as well as unlimited calls and text messages. The SIM is also available in an eSIM form so you can download it prior to your trip. You can get it on the official Orange website or in an Orange store or Relay store which are typically located at airports. The eSIM is a great option for those who want to travel with your own smartphone and avoid roaming fees.

Orange was launched in 1994, uk online phone Shopping Sites with a pledge to make mobile phones affordable for anyone. It was a bold idea at a time when mobile phones were considered a flashy gadget by bankers. Its name was a reference to the words of the fruit, and was unique in the field. The brand was created by an in-house team led by Hans Snook and Chris Moss and featured distinctive branding and a catchy slogan "The future's bright; the future's orange."

Hutchison Whampoa acquired Microtel Communications Ltd in 1990. The next year, they changed the name the company to Orange Personal Communications Services Ltd and launched the first GSM 1800 MHz network. The company was a limited company up to 2000 when it was acquired by France Telecom.

The Orange brand remained used worldwide, including in France, Germany and Italy. In 2010 the UK business joined with T-Mobile which was owned by Deutsche Telekom, to create EE. The company has since switched its focus to 4G, and is currently investing billions in it. The name is disappearing in the UK as the company is now selling EE products in its 600 high-street shops.

Orange sponsored the Baftas as well as the Women's Prize for Fiction. Millions of pounds were spent on sponsorships. However, the brand's sponsorship of these events was later cancelled. Orange also sponsored Wednesdays at cinemas, which included two tickets at the price of one ticket if you were an Orange customer. Orange's dedication to cinema is evident in its iconic advertisements featuring celebrities like Dennis Hopper, Macaulay-Culkin and Carrie Fisher.

Jamster

Advertising Standards Authority (ASA) has issued a harsh warning to Jamster. It is difficult to pick up any mobile phone in the UK and not see an advertisement for the company. The company aired ads featuring its characters for its ringtones, Crazy Frog and Sweetie Chick. However, many users complained about the shady nature of the advertisements.

The complaint claims that the ads misled the consumers by implying that they would receive free ringtones if they sent messages to the short number shown in an ad. In actual fact, the company tacked on recurring premium short messaging service charges to the customers' monthly phone bills. The company also charged for multiple messaging messages even when users didn't download a single ringtone.

The terms and conditions of the service were not clearly defined. People who received the bill weren't informed of the fact that the service was subscription-based. The company's ads violated ASA guidelines and were ordered to stop using these characters in future TV commercials.

Jamster is owned by VeriSign and sells ringtones as well as other content to mobile users. The company provides mobile services in the United States, Europe and Canada. It also offers streaming music on PCs and digital TVs.

In Germany its ringtones as well as wallpaper characters like Sweetie and the Chick and Crazy Frog have become popular. They have even been incorporated into a PlayStation 2 game.
